$15m investment supports Austral’s Rocklands expansion
What happened
Austral Resources secured a $15m investment to expand the Rocklands copper processing facility and support studies into alternative power solutions. The funding is positioned to help restart Rocklands and scale processing capacity, and management says it will support the restart path to production planning.
